What time span do you think game stories cover? Doesn't Shadows Of Amn canonically take place over about six months? Including ToB it's like .... two years? But in-game you can actually complete the entire fucking thing in a few weeks?
Even Kingmaker only takes about five years, right? Wrath is completed in about two years because of the six month timeskip in the Abyss and how long it takes to accumulate the armies to clear the way to Iz.

And those are pretty unusual. NWN2 is only a few months, PoE1 is a few months, PoE2 is like... a few weeks? I'm not sure how long canonically, but there's a challenge mode that ends the game if you fail to get to Ukaizo quickly enough. Underrail happens over about two weeks. Elves have lower fertility rates than humans and live for nearly a thousand years in FR lore. The cultural and biological drive to have as many children as possible as fast as possible simply isn’t there if your own lifespan is longer than most civilizations. Elves can take their time because they have the luxury of time.
